Furan resin is a category of resins derived from furan derivatives, such as furfuryl alcohol or furfural, and finds application in adhesives, as well as in infusing and coating compositions. Primarily, furan resins serve as chemically resistant cement types and act as binders for explosives, wood adhesives, and fiber composites.
The primary types of furan resins include furfuryl alcohol resin, furfural resin, bran ketone resin, and branone formaldehyde resin. Furfuryl Alcohol Resin is a polymer resulting from the self-polycondensation of furfuryl alcohol monomer. This polymer forms as the furfuryl alcohol molecules undergo self-polycondensation, reacting with the active alpha-hydrogen of another furfuryl alcohol molecule in the presence of an acid catalyst. Applications for these resins span various industries, encompassing adhesives and sealants, automobiles, paint and coatings, plastics, and foundries. End-users, such as those in the construction and chemical industries, utilize furan resins for diverse purposes.

The furan resin market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$19.6 billion in 2025 to $20.86 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.5%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to growth of foundry and casting industries, increasing demand for corrosion-resistant materials, expansion of industrial adhesive applications, availability of furfural-based raw materials, rising use in chemical processing environments.
The furan resin market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$26.87 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.5%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to increasing demand for sustainable industrial resins, rising adoption in automotive and construction sectors, expansion of high-performance composite materials, growing focus on environmentally friendly binders, increasing investments in specialty resin development. Major trends in the forecast period include increasing use of bio-based resin systems, rising adoption in foundry applications, growing demand for chemical-resistant materials, expansion of high-temperature adhesive applications, enhanced focus on sustainable binder solutions.
The rising demand for lightweight and fuel-efficient automobiles globally is expected to drive the growth of the furan resin market. Lightweight and fuel-efficient automobiles utilize advanced structural materials that enhance fuel economy while maintaining safety and performance. Many automotive components are mixed or coated with furan resins and their derivatives, improving tensile strength and reducing vehicle weight. Furan resins offer benefits such as lightweight, corrosion resistance, and high strength.
